The Elements of an Engagement Ring


The diamond will most likely account for most of the overall cost of the ring. Educating yourself on the four Cs will ensure the making of an informed decision.

The setting, also referred to as the head, is the part that holds the diamond in place and is manufactured to fit the size and shape of the diamond you choose. The two main types are either prong or bezel settings. With round diamonds, you will have an option of either four or six-claw. A four-claw setting shows a bit more diamond, while a six-claw setting offers a slight security advantage.

The band, also referred to as the engagement ring setting, is available in a variety of styles from the classic solitaire to diamond accented styles. Your choices of metals are 18ct white or yellow gold, and platinum.

ESTABLISH YOUR BUDGET:


Diamonds vary greatly in price, but there is most certainly a diamond to fit your taste and budget. The idea that a man should spend roughly two months' salary on a diamond engagement ring is a widely accepted convention. Learn about the various options available to you before you set a budget. You'll be faced with decisions about the shape of the diamond, the setting style, and the choice of metal.

SELECT THE DIAMOND:


The next step in buying an engagement ring is to educate yourself on each of the four Cs: Cut,Clarity, Carat and Colour, and how each of these can affect price. By understanding these qualities you can determine which traits are most important to you, and you can find a balance between them that best suits your needs.
